Short description
Written for both automobile and motorcycle owners, this completely illustrated guidebook helps beginners develop the skills needed to restore and repair sheet steel and aluminum alloys for restoration and customizing. Topics include welding, tackling rust damage, creating paper templates, and finishing techniques. Hands-on sections explain how to build everything from a simple dash to a fender for a rare automobile.
